The Role

Do you thrive in complex and innovative software development?

If so, we have an awesome opportunity for a Firmware Development Engineer with a focus on embedded power management software development, adapting AI for optimization, system level control and ASIC debug. You will be responsible for the full complement of AMD's APU and CPU designs, developing features and driving continuous improvement in all areas.

The Person

We are looking for an individual that loves embedded software, inspired by advanced technologies, thrives in cross team collaboration and is excited at the prospect of rapidly switching gears and moving to new programs and technologies.

Key Responsibilities

  • Assume end-to-end responsibility for post-silicon activities related to power, performance and system management in CPU/APU products.
  • Hands-on firmware development for embedded u-controllers in C, feature enablement and test plans.
  • Analyze existing firmware performance and identify optimization opportunities using AI/ML
  • Design and implement machine learning algorithms to enhance firmware efficiency and reliability
  • Optimize AI models for deployment on resource-constrained embedded systems
  • Prototype FW power management features for future chips by implementing them on existing products and studying their efficiency
  • Develop automated firmware tuning systems using reinforcement learning or genetic algorithm
